Changes the point size for scalable typographic fonts
Notes:
12 is the factory default setting.
•
Point Size refers to the height of the characters in the font. One point equals
•
approximately 1/72 of an inch.
Point sizes can be increased or decreased in 0.25-point increments.
•
Specifies the font pitch for scalable monospaced fonts
Notes:
10 is the factory default setting.
•
Pitch refers to the number of fixed-space characters per inch (cpi).
•
Pitch can be increased or decreased in 0.01-cpi increments.
•
For nonscalable monospaced fonts, the pitch appears on the display but
•
cannot be changed.
Specifies the orientation of text and graphics on the page
Notes:
Portrait is the factory default setting.
•
Portrait prints text and graphics parallel to the short edge of the page.
•
Landscape prints text and graphics parallel to the long edge of the page.
